Standard Naming for Domino related services

This document defines standardized service names to standardize configuration. Some of the services like name services, SMTP gateways might need multiple names, which are added to configuration.

The host name turns into the FQDN by adding the defined internet domain. This schema can be also used for test, QA and development environments adding sub domains (example: smtp.dev.company.com).

Well-known protocol specific names

Service Name Description
ldap Domino LDAP as the central directory over LDAPS
auth Domino OIDC server
imap Domino IMAP
pop3 Domino POP3 if needed
mx External mail exchanger for inbound mail
smtp Internal SMTP relay host
smtp-internal Internal SMTP mails only/no relay
smtp-relay External SMTP Relay host in DMZ

Application Services

Applications which might be implemented using different type of technologies depending on the environment. The following table lists the HCL family products, but could be complemented with other corporate applications like NextCloud.

Service Name Description
webmail Verse
mobile Traveler
nomad Nomad
files WebDav
chat Sametime Chat
meetings Sametime Meetings

System Services

System related services are usually not end user facing. They are either used by servers or admins & developers.

Service Name Description
git Git server (e.g. Gitea)
registry Container Registry (Docker/Harbor)
software Software distribution server
clamav ClamAV anti-virus service
clamav-mirror ClamAV private mirror for pattern updates
ubuntu-mirror Ubuntu local mirror
redhat-mirror Redhat local mirror

Monitoring

Monitoring is its own kind of domain providing services for IT, mainly but also auditors and corporate security.

Service Name Description
mon Monitoring (e.g. Grafana)
logs Log server (e.g. Splunk, Grafana Loki)

Network

Services which are more network related.

Service Name Description
ns DNS service
ntp Time Service
proxy Forward proxy for outgoing connections (Squid)
vpn VPN server (WireGuard)
